TK's American Cafe is a neighborhood sports bar and restaurant that opened in Danbury, Connecticut in 1990. It was founded by Tom "TK" Kennedy. The building is actually Danbury's oldest continually operating tavern; a gravestone mural outside tells the story of all the previous businesses that called the spot home. Beginning in 1928, the site was home to CK Moore Autos: a car dealership. The first tavern to open on the site was Bennie Pane's Stone Grill in 1933; they obtained the first liquor license in the city. This was then followed by Pane's Restaurant (1937-48), Negri's Grill (1948-59), the 6 & 7 Restaurant (1959-78), The Bushwacker (1978-88), and A.W. Shucks (1988-90) before Kennedy took over. TK's nearly went on the gravestone mural themselves until they started having 10¢ Wing Night every Tuesday. Wing Night is still going strong after more than 30 years and TK's serves over 15,000 of their famous wings each week. I've been to TK's more times than I can count over the years because from 2003-07 I was a college student down the street at Western Connecticut State University. TK's is a very popular watering hole for WestConn students. I celebrated several birthdays here; if you go on your birthday then you get one free wing for every year that you've lived. I recently stopped by for dinner (for old times' sake). After looking over the menu (which consists of 76 wing flavors), I decided to order five Gold Rush (hot sauce & honey mustard), five Ugly (honey BBQ, suicide & bacon bits), five American Outlaw (honey BBQ, liquid smoke, bourbon & cayenne pepper), and five of the Four Horsemen (cocktail of three hot sauces, horseradish, xtra hot cayenne & sesame seeds). I thoroughly enjoyed all of them, but I have a soft spot for the Gold Rush wings. The Four Horsemen are probably the hottest wings I've ever had. At one time they were the hottest wings on the menu, but that honor now belongs to the Bushwacker wings (I didn't have the guts to try them). I washed everything down with pours of "TwoConn Easy Ale" by Two Roads Brewing and "Bengali" IPA by Sixpoint Brewery. TK's will always be a special place to me!
